SPOT Image’s programming team handles some 2,500 programming requests a year, offering a custom support service that takes into account application needs, satellite programming parameters, the physical features of the customer’s area of interest, level of service, availability of satellite capacity, weather conditions, and the technical capabilities of each SPOT satellite. How are the 2.5-meter images acquired? Imagery at a resolution of 2.5 meters in the panchromatic band is obtained using a sampling concept unique to SPOT 5, called Supermode. This concept processes two 5-meter panchromatic images acquired simultaneously to generate a single image at a resolution of 2.5 meters.
